
Become a Thunder Ambassador
March 4, 2016 - ECHL (ECHL)
Adirondack Thunder News Release
Glens Falls, NY - The Adirondack Thunder, proud ECHL affiliate of the Calgary Flames, have announced the "Thunder Ambassadors" program, effective today, as part of the Thunder's roll out of its 2016-17 season ticket campaign.
The Thunder Ambassadors program provides an opportunity to our most loyal fans to become an extension of the Adirondack Thunder team, staff and brand. Thunder Ambassadors will help the franchise grow the Thunder brand throughout the Adirondack region in an effort to maximize the team's awareness, improve its deliverables in the community and at home games and provide sales assistance and referrals as the franchise rebuilds its season tickets and customer base.
Thunder Ambassadors will promote Thunder hockey and ticket packages to family, friends, co-workers and colleagues and will assist the Thunder with staffing of select giveaway nights, promotions and exclusive events on an as needed basis. As a reward for devoting their time and efforts to the Thunder, all Thunder Ambassadors will receive a limited edition, one-of-a-kind Thunder Ambassadors scarf from the Adirondack Thunder.
"It became apparent to us during our fan forums that we had a group of loyal supporters willing and eager to help in a variety of ways," Adirondack Thunder President Brian Petrovek said. "The Thunder Ambassadors program is designed to make use of that expressed passion and talent, making our fans an extension of our brand, helping to improve the way we operate as a business and help us identify new customers. We're excited about this initiative and look forward to expanding our reach through these new relationships."
